    Skidmark and Con's Fancy were open, each of which don't see much action in normal to low snow years. Up higher, Tiger Claw is smooth and filled and all the Rope dee entrances are happening (2 requires good snowpack). Meatgrinder was deep as well, no rocks this year.

    It's just a killer year for Silverton. The last day there last week, I got a line down the right side of the Tony T tube that will be a death bed memory of soft, deep, freefalling spindrift.

    Silverton isn't terribly difficult to figure out but doing a guided day isn't a terrible idea. There's a lot of nooks and crannies, and the guides can help with that, but most of the main lines are mostly pretty obvious.
    With the storm this week there most likely won't be much terrain open the first couple days. You'll still have a great time, don't get me wrong, but don't expect everything on the map to open on Wednesday. Most likely things will progressively open as the week progresses, the storm slows down, and they bomb more stuff. Guided groups always get to go a little further than the unwashed, unguided masses.
    Have fun!

    Fucking A. Heading down Friday, flying my $39 heli lap Saturday. Somehow got the hall pass to go the following weekend too. 2 short trips better than 1 long trip so I'll get my bang out of the unguided season pass. They raised the price from $150 to $199 but still a good deal.

    I skied Breck last week. Someone was bitching the day pass cost $260 or something like that. I'd rather go heli skiing for $189.
